Scientists Achieve Low Recycling No-ELM H-mode Regime in EAST
Date: 2019/12/17 Author: YE Yang

Chinese scientists of theInstitute of Plasma Physics under Hefei Institutes of Physical Science has made new progress in the research of EAST low-recycling no-ELM high-confinement mode operation.

This work was done by XU Guosheng and his team and waspublished in Nuclear Fusion.

A highly reproducible spontaneous no-ELM regime was achieved in the EAST superconducting tokamak with the extensive lithium wall coating or real-time lithium powder/granules injection.

Unlike the previously published high-recycling strong electrostatic edge coherent mode (ECM) dominated no-ELM operation [Y. Ye, G.S. Xu, et al 2017 Nuclear Fusion 57 086041], this regime exhibited a clear low-density dependence and was less correlated with the pedestal turbulence. The energy confinement enhancement factor could be up to 1 and it was compatible with the fully non-inductive operation.

Diagnostic data and ELITE/NIMROD simulations indicated that the low pedestal foot density and the ion diamagnetic stability effect may play a key role in the achievement of this regime. The low pedestal foot density might have a strong ion diamagnetic stabilizing effect, which could stabilize the medium-n and high-n Peeling-Ballooning modes.

In this regime, the recycling neutral particles from the wall surface were significantly reduced, and the pedestal fueling effect was weakened, which had a commonality with the expected high heating power, low pedestal fueling effect on the future reactors. Therefore, the development of this research provided a useful reference for the control of ELMs on future fusion experimental devices.
